Description: Aaptiv is a popular fitness app featuring a large audio-guided workout library with classes for different fitness goals. The app offers workouts across cardio, strength, yoga, pilates, running, and more. Aaptiv allows you to select a class based on music genre, trainer, duration, and type. It provides an immersive audio experience without video, focused on motivating and guiding members.

Description: openWorkout is an open source workout and fitness tracking platform. It allows you to create and log custom exercises and workouts, track your progress over time, and analyze fitness metrics. It is a free and privacy-focused alternative to proprietary fitness apps.

Pros & Cons Analysis

Aaptiv
Aaptiv
Pros
  • Effective for motivation and coaching during workouts
  • Convenient hands-free experience
  • Large variety and selection of classes
  • Customizable experience
  • Good for beginners
  • Syncs with other fitness apps
Cons
  • No video demonstrations of moves/form
  • Must have smartphone/device accessible during workouts
  • Requires wifi/data connection
  • Monthly subscription fee
  • Limited use without subscription
openWorkout
openWorkout
Pros
  • Free and open source
  • No ads or tracking
  • Customizable workout plans
  • Offline access
  • Available on iOS, Android, macOS, Windows, Linux
  • Active development community
Cons
  • Basic UI/UX
  • Limited preloaded exercises
  • Requires some tech know-how to set up and use optimally
  • Not many ready-made workout plans or guidance
